使用的是apache2.2,在网上下载的安装程序名叫 httpd-2.2.22-win32-x86-openssl-0.9.8
如何在windows上搭建一个apache http server? (在TG233的http server 远程升级测试中,用的就是这种方式)
1. 下载并安装apache 2.2
2. 安装完后,把modem要下载的文件放在目录D:\Program Files\Apache Software Foundation\Apache2.2\htdocs\TG233 下,TG233是自己建立的目录(TRs里要求建立此目录)。
3. 按照TRs要求,在目录下放置两个指定文件供modem下载,分别是文件software_version.txt和build文件。
打开apache http server:通过打开bin目录下httpd.exe文件,即打开了http server。(有一个鸡毛标识的窗口弹出来)
4. 在本地打开web浏览器(此处用的是firefox打开,最好使用IE,这样不会有其他的代理信息影响),地址栏输入http://localhost/TG233/ (使用localhost时,注意在浏览器的工具-->选项-->高级-->不使用代理的框中加上localhost,与别的内容
以‘,’号间隔。)
5. 通过IE打开http server上的文件的方法是,在IE中输入http://192.168.1.111/TG233/,然后回车,即可以看到TG233底下的文件信息。(此处192.168.1.111为本机网卡的地址)
6. 本机另一网卡的地址是公网地址10.11.59.148,则在能ping通此地址的别的pc上要访问TG233下的文件,在IE中输入http://10.11.59.148/TG233回车即可看到文件,点击文件可以下载。
在apache安装目录中的文件夹htdoc,在htdoc中创建如下:
./TG233
./TG233/software_version.txt
./TG233/ZVK7AA10.512
如何在linux上搭建一个apache web server?测试使用的是gentoo系统。
1.下载apache的linux版本;
2. 安装,下载的apache放在/home目录下;
进入apache安装文件的httpd-2.2.22,执行
(1) sh configure
(2) make
(3) make install
(4) 打开web server:apache2/bin/目录下,执行命令./apachectl -k start 打开web server
打开浏览器,输入http://localhost/ 显示it works,注意如果不能显示,需要设置浏览器不使用任何代理,再试。
(5) 在apache2/htdoc/目录下创建TG233目录,里面放置文件。在浏览器中输入http://localhost/TG233,则可以在网页上看到TG233下的文件。
安装完成,默认安装在/usr/local/apache2
转自 : http://jyliu0228.blog.163.com/blog/static/1180244282012102962620610/